WebFeb 10, 2024 · In 2024, 26% of Black adults ages 25 and older – 7.5 million people – had earned a bachelor’s degree or more, up from 15% in 2000. Growing shares of Black women and Black men have earned a bachelor’s degree or more over the last two decades. WebNationwide, the black student graduation rate remains at a dismally low 42 percent. But the rate has improved by three percentage points over the past two years. More encouraging is the fact that over the past seven years the black student graduation rate has improved at almost all of the nation's highest-ranked universities.

By comparison, just under 70 percent of... WebFeb 23, 2024 · Total college enrollment (graduate and undergraduate) has fallen 5.7% since fall 2024, the semester before the pandemic started. Undergraduate enrollment decreased by 7.6% during that same period. Enrollment at community colleges fell 16.2%. Graduate enrollment, however, has increased by 4.2%.
